Bhubaneswar: Mohes Kumar Behera, an officer of the Indian Railway Service of Engineers (IRSE), has assumed office of the Additional General Manager (AGM) of East Coast Railway (ECoR).
Prior to this, he was working as Chief Planning and Design Engineer of ECoR at Bhubaneswar.
Behera graduated from the erstwhile University College of Engineering, Burla, in Civil Engineering and did MTech in Ocean Engineering from IIT, Madras. He joined Indian Railways in 1991. He worked in various capacities – Chief Bridge Engineer, Chief Engineer (Bridge Rehabilitation) in ECoR; Group General Manager of Rites at Bhubaneswar, Chief Engineer (Construction) of Ganga Bridge under East Central Railway at Patna and Munger and many other crucial posts, including Senior Divisional Engineer (Co-Ordination), Sambalpur, Deputy Chief Vigilance Officer in ECoR and Deputy Chief Engineer (con) in Northeast Frontier Railway, an ECoR release said.
